Holme upon Spalding Moor is a small village located in the East Riding of Yorkshire, England. Situated approximately 18 miles east of York, it lies on the edge of the Yorkshire Wolds and is surrounded by picturesque countryside. The village is known for its peaceful and rural setting, making it an attractive destination for those seeking a tranquil retreat.
The history of Holme upon Spalding Moor can be traced back to the Roman period, with evidence of Roman settlements in the area. However, it wasn't until the 19th century that the village began to grow in significance due to the development of agriculture and the arrival of the railway.
Today, the village is home to a tightly-knit community of approximately 3,000 residents. It offers a range of amenities, including a primary school, local shops, a medical center, and several pubs. The village also boasts a beautiful 12th-century parish church, St. Nicholas, which adds to its historical charm.
Holme upon Spalding Moor is well-positioned for outdoor enthusiasts, with numerous walking and cycling routes in the surrounding countryside. The nearby Yorkshire Wolds provide a stunning backdrop for exploration, offering panoramic views and a chance to spot local wildlife.
Overall, Holme upon Spalding Moor is a quaint and idyllic village that offers a peaceful escape from city life. Its rich history, beautiful landscapes, and tight-knit community make it a desirable place to live or visit in Yorkshire.
